SEO优化其实是一种思维,所谓思维就是说只要有搜索框的地方,就有SEO优化。然而搜索引擎优化,不仅仅是指百度或是谷歌,有可能是指任何有搜索框的地方。当然现在目前国内流量最大的还是百度,所以我们重点还是针对百度来做SEO优化,最近不仅是百度,还是谷歌都是着重说明了在移动端的页面,影响排名的一个非常关键的因素是首屏的打开时间必须是在2秒之内完成。
如果要在2秒之内打开网页的话。在流量的获取会发生倾斜,倾斜到那种打开速度非常快,因为速度快,所以用户的体验自然就好,因为人们的碎片时间没有耐心,对吧?打开速度越快越好,最好是秒开。如果移动搜索出的这个页面首屏加载时间非常慢,3秒以上,这个网页将会被打压。所以做移动端的优化,首先第一个要求就是网页打开速度要快。
那么怎样才能让网页打开速度快?给大家几个方法,第一个将同类型的资源在服务器端进行压缩合并,减少网络请求的次数和资源的体积。
这是什么意思?就是我们在写网页的时候会用到图片文件、会用到CSS样式表文件,对吧?如果每个图片和样式表都是一个链接,它都会到服务端去做一次请求。请求其实是个非常复杂的过程,它包括了三次握手,你要发确认,服务器要返回,返回之后你再返回。这样的一个来来回回,每一次请求都会被多次加载。对吧?就是在服务器这边多次来回,所以尽量用一次,把所有的样式,图片都缓存下来,这样的话就可以减少网络延时,加快响应速度。
同时第二点就是刚才说的利用通用资源,所谓通用资源,比如说这张图片logo,对吧?所有的地方都要用这一个链接,因为它加载一次之后他就会缓存下来。所有的地方你不要再用第二个,CSS样式也一样,尽量用同一个链接地址,这样的话就可以充分利用浏览器的缓存机制。第三点,如果你用CDN服务的话,你就可以把这些给它缓存到CDN上去,服务器会让离用户物理距离最近的地方去获取,这样数据下载就会很快,对不对?那么,非首屏内容我们可以用JS做成暂不加载,也就是说当你的手还没滑到下面的时候,这个图片是不加载的,把网络的带宽就留给首屏网页的进求。
在页面的渲染方面有几点要注意的,第一个着重的就是刚才说的像CSS样式,要写在头部样式表中,将这个CSS样式写在头部的样式表中,减少由CCs文件网络请求造成的阻塞。第二个将这个JavaScript文件加载放到HTML文档的最后,或者使用一步加载的方式,避免了JS的阻塞。对于非文字元素,比如图片或视频,指定宽度和高度,避免了浏览器重新排版。总之,如果你做移动端的SEO优化,你必须加快网页的加载速度,可以使用通用的加速解决方案,比如说百度MAP这个,大家可以去具体了解一下。 今天就和大家讲到这里,希望大家在移动端SEO优化上面得到进步。
本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/65794.html
如有侵犯您的合法权益请发邮件951076433@qq.com联系删除